Principal Design Engineer



Job description

Your new company

Here in Hays Recruitment, our Pharmaceutical client in Dublin is hiring a Principal Device Development Engineer.


Your new role
Here’s how the Principal Device Development Assurance Scientist/Engineer role will make an impact:

  • Support and provide guidance for device development programs throughout the design and development lifecycle for Combination products, including prefilled pens, prefilled syringes, auto-injectors, and medical devices, by ensuring compliance with design control requirements outlined in Quality Management System, and relevant Regulations (e.g. 21 CFR 820, 21 CFR Part 4, Regulation EU 2017/745) and International Device Standards (e.g: ISO13485, ISO14971).
  • Establish, maintain and provide guidance on the contents of Design History Files for development programs, for various program types – in-house design authority, collaborative development, and acquired programs; this shall include associated activity plans and timelines.
  • Collaborate with, and influence, affiliated sites, collaborators and third parties to ensure appropriate objective evidence and controls are established and maintained in line with program deliverables.
  • Support the integration, and assess compliance with design control requirements, of acquired combination products and medical devices, into the Global Device Development product portfolio.
  • Support Risk Management activities for development programs through the implementation of ISO 14971:2019

    What you'll need to succeed

  • Education – Degree / Masters in engineering or science/life science
  • Industry – Medical Device or Pharmaceutical (with devices)
  • Min 5–7 years at similar level/ or 5–10 years general experience in industry
  • Direct experience of device development and manufacturing operations activities for device or drug/device systems in a GMP environment
  • Experience in the implementation of device design controls and ISO/FDA requirements as applicable to device design
  • Demonstrated understanding of GMP, Quality Management System, and relevant Regulations (e.g. 21 CFR 820, 21 CFR Part 4, Regulation EU 2017/745) and International Device Standards (e.g: ISO13485, ISO14971
